Michael Phelps is widely regarded as the greatest Olympian ever, with 28 Olympic medals, including an unmatched 23 golds. While other legends like Usain Bolt and Carl Lewis are often compared, Phelps's dominance, even in a sport offering multiple medal opportunities, remains unparalleled. His 23 gold medals are more than double the tally of his closest competitors.
